{"repo":"ArmorerLabs/Armorer","free":true,"listed":false,"github":"https://github.com/ArmorerLabs/Armorer","clone":"git clone https://github.com/ArmorerLabs/Armorer.git","description":"Local control plane for running AI agents with sandboxes, approvals, guardrails, credentials, and runtime health.","language":"TypeScript","stars":60,"topics":["agent-runtime","agent-security","ai-agents","ai-security","cybersecurity","devtools","docker","guardrails","llm-security","local-first"],"license":"MIT","category":"ai-agents","readme_excerpt":"Armorer Local control plane for AI agents Run native Armorer Flue agents with local sandboxes, guided setup, credential handling, guardrails, approvals, jobs, logs, and runtime health in one place. Run any agent. Securely. Local-first by default. Experimental release candidate: Armorer is under active development. The current release train is intended for early testers who are comfortable with local agent runtimes, Docker/Colima, and rapidly evolving setup flows. Authorized private integration environments additionally run pnpm test:private with a compatible Vault runtime. Runtime use also needs Rust/Cargo for the native Armorer gateway and authorized access to the private Armorer Vault runtime. Set ARMORER VAULT BIN to a compatible private artifact, or set ARMORER VAULT SOURCE DIR to a separate private ArmorerLabs/Armorer-Vault checkout. pnpm dev , pnpm start , and the CLI run fail-closed Vault preflights. OSS builds and tests never download or package a private runtime. Production appliances and proprietary products are distributed only through authenticated private channels, not this public repository or its releases. See Private distributions.
